服务器安装什么防止入侵
-
服务器安装防止入侵的软件和技术是非常重要的,它能保护服务器免受未经授权的访问和恶意攻击。以下是几种常见的防止入侵的方法:
-
防火墙:防火墙是服务器安全的第一道防线。它可以监测和控制进出服务器的网络通信流量,并根据事先设定的策略来允许或阻止特定的连接。防火墙可以过滤和拦截恶意的网络访问请求,从而减少入侵的风险。
-
入侵检测系统(IDS):入侵检测系统可以实时监测服务器上的网络流量和系统行为,以便及时发现并报告可能的入侵行为。IDS可以根据已知的攻击特征,检测出恶意的网络活动,并采取相应的防护措施。常见的IDS包括网络IDS和主机IDS。
-
安全漏洞管理:定期对服务器进行安全漏洞扫描和评估,确保及时修补漏洞。攻击者通常会利用服务器中的安全漏洞来进行入侵。及时更新操作系统和软件补丁,可以减少入侵风险。
-
强密码和账号管理:为服务器设置强密码,并对账号进行管理。强密码应包含大小写字母、数字和特殊字符,并定期更换密码。同时,应限制并审查服务器上的用户账号,并为每个账号分配最低权限原则,以防止攻击者通过猜测或获取用户账号密码进行入侵。
-
加密通信:通过使用SSL/TLS协议来加密服务器与客户端之间的通信,可以防止中间人攻击和数据窃取。在配置服务器时,应确保使用最新和安全的加密算法和证书。
-
日志管理与监控:密切监控和分析服务器的日志,以及时发现和处理潜在的入侵行为。日志记录可以提供关于安全事件和攻击的重要信息,并帮助管理者及时采取措施来响应和防范入侵。
-
定期备份:定期备份服务器的数据和配置,以防止数据意外损坏、丢失或被入侵者篡改。备份数据应存储在一个安全的位置,并进行定期的验证和测试以确保恢复的可行性。
综上所述,通过采取以上措施,能够有效地提高服务器的安全性,防止入侵和减少安全事件的发生。然而,安全是一个持续的过程,服务器的安全性需要不断的维护和更新来适应不断变化的安全威胁。
1年前 -
-
服务器安装防止入侵的方法有很多种,下面列举了以下五种常见的方法:
-
防火墙:防火墙是服务器安全的首要防线,它可以过滤进出服务器的网络流量,阻止恶意攻击和非法访问。防火墙可以根据预先设定的规则决定是否允许特定的网络通信,可以设置允许和拒绝的IP地址、端口等。
-
安全补丁和更新:定期应用软件厂商发布的安全补丁和更新可以修补服务器系统中的安全漏洞,防止黑客利用这些漏洞进行攻击。及时更新操作系统、数据库和应用软件的补丁和更新是保证服务器安全的一项重要措施。
-
强密码和账户管理:使用复杂、长且难以猜测的密码可以大大增加黑客破解密码的难度。同时,要定期更改密码,并禁止使用默认的账户名和密码。另外,也要注意对服务器上的账户进行规范的管理,必要时限制特定用户的权限。
-
安全监控和日志管理:安装安全监控系统可以实时监视服务器的运行状况和网络流量,发现可能的入侵行为并及时采取相应的措施。同时,对服务器产生的日志进行管理和分析,可以追踪和发现异常行为,并提供证据以供后续分析。
-
适当的网络拓扑:将服务器放置在受限的网络环境中,使用DMZ(Demilitarized Zone)将服务器隔离出来,可以减少服务器受到攻击的风险。此外,还可以使用虚拟专用网络(VPN)等方式进行远程访问,减少暴露在公网上的风险。
综上所述,通过使用防火墙、安装安全补丁、强化密码和账户管理、安装安全监控系统以及适当的网络拓扑,可以有效防止服务器入侵,并保障服务器的安全。
1年前 -
-
在服务器上部署有效的防御措施是保护服务器免受入侵的重要步骤。以下是一些常用的防御措施以及安装方法和操作流程:
- 防火墙(Firewall):
防火墙是一种网络安全设备,用于监控和控制进出服务器的网络流量。它可阻止未经授权的访问、控制网络通信并提供安全性。安装防火墙的方法如下:
- Linux:常用的防火墙软件有iptables和firewalld。对于iptables,可以使用以下命令安装和配置:
sudo apt-get install iptables s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T (允许HTTP访问) sudo iptables -A INPUT -j DROP (禁止其他访问)- Windows:Windows服务器自带Windows防火墙,可以通过控制面板中的“Windows Defender Firewall”进行配置。
- 更新和维护操作系统:
及时更新和维护操作系统是服务器安全性的关键。更新操作系统可以修复已知安全漏洞,并添加新的安全功能。以下是针对不同操作系统的更新和维护方法:
- Linux:使用系统自带的包管理器(如yum、apt-get)更新软件包。例如,使用以下命令更新Ubuntu系统的软件包:
sudo apt-get update sudo apt-get upgrade- Windows:打开控制面板中的“Windows Update”设置,使系统自动下载和安装最新的更新。
- 安全身份验证措施:
使用强密码和多因素身份验证(MFA)可以有效防止恶意用户破解账户密码,并增加服务器的安全性。以下是一些安全身份验证措施的安装方法:
- 强密码:确保密码足够复杂,并且定期更改密码。
- 多因素身份验证:为服务器启用MFA,例如,在Linux上可以使用Google Authenticator。安装方法如下:
sudo apt-get install libpam-google-authenticator sudo nano /etc/pam.d/sshd将以下行添加到
/etc/pam.d/sshd文件的末尾:auth required pam_google_authenticator.so重新启动SSH服务。
- 安装入侵检测系统(IDS):
入侵检测系统能够监控服务器上的网络流量和日志,及时发现可能的入侵活动。以下是使用Snort作为示例的IDS的安装方法:
- Linux:使用以下命令安装Snort:
sudo apt-get install snort编辑
/etc/snort/snort.conf文件,配置规则和日志路径。然后启动Snort服务。- Windows:下载并安装Snort for Windows,然后按照提示进行配置。
- 安装防病毒软件:
在服务器上安装防病毒软件可以检测并删除恶意软件、病毒和其他威胁。以下是使用ClamAV作为示例的安装方法:
- Linux:使用以下命令安装ClamAV:
sudo apt-get update sudo apt-get install clamav更新病毒定义并运行扫描:
sudo freshclam sudo clamscan -r /- Windows:下载并安装ClamAV for Windows,然后按照提示进行配置。
以上是一些常用的服务器入侵防御措施和安装方法。根据服务器操作系统的不同,可能需要采取其他特定的防御措施。最重要的是定期更新和维护服务器,并及时应用补丁和安全更新。
1年前 - 防火墙(Firewall):